Flower Size 1/2" [1.25 cm]

Found in San Gabriel, Cundinamarca Colombia at elevations around 1200 to 1400 meters as a mini-miniature sized, cool growing epiphyte with a fan of 8 to 12, linear, obtuse, complantate leaves that blooms in the spring on 1 to 2, axillary, 3" [7.5 cm] long, few flowered inflorescence carrying all the flowers towards the apex.

This species has a shorter, straight column held in line with the anther instead of at right angles as in M bicolor and the lip has only a single triangular portion which at the apex of the lip. That triangular portion is somewhat conduplicate and has slightly erose margins

According to The Native Colombian Orchid Series Vol 2 says that there are 5 described Colombian species, M bicolor, M junctum, M oberonia, M wullschlaegelianum and M xiphophorum and this species does not seem to fit well to any of those.
